@article{Rogowska-Cybulska_2015, title={O sposobach tworzenia nazw miejscowości w świetle etymologii ludowej}, volume={10}, url={https://journals.akademicka.pl/lv/article/view/2779}, DOI={10.12797/LV.10.2015.19.18}, abstractNote={<p><strong>On creation of place names in the light of folk etymology</strong></p> <p>The paper discusses the ways in which Polish place names were created, in the light of their folk etymologies. The author uses the example of selected morphological reinterpretations of place names from various regions of Poland. By comparing folk-etymologized place names, and the words and expression that they indicate as bases for derivation, the paper shows that, in fact, folk etymology divides Polish toponyms into similar structural categories as scientific etymology: the primary, the secondary, and the compound. Very few re-etymologized place names do not fit into any of these types. In details, however, pseudoetymologies differ from the results of onomastic research with regard to the methods of creation of place names. Among other differences, the former tend to prefer certain structural types, especially compounds, and display a greater degree of tolerance for phonetic differences.</p> <p> </p>}, number={19}, journal={LingVaria}, author={Rogowska-Cybulska, Ewa}, year={2015}, month={mar.}, pages={271–283} }
